    Caribbean Brewers: Transfer Pricing‚ Ethics and Governance Case Summary Gera International is a well established international brand of beer that is ranked amongst the top three brands of beer in the world. With transportation prices rising‚ Gera International decided to purchase a plant in Antigua in 2005 and they renamed the subsidiary‚ Caribbean Brewers‚ Inc. (CBI).     ROYAL CARIBBEAN CRUISES LTD. TIME CONTEXT : 1968 - present SUMMARY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. is a global cruise vacation company that operates Royal Caribbean International‚ Celebrity Cruises‚ Pullmantur and Azamara Cruises. The company has a combined total of 35 ships in service and seven under construction.
